Peter S Lobster Ltd
Profile
Peter S Lobster Ltd is a company located at Glenwood, Canada,address is 3905 Hwy 3,Zipcode is B0W 1W0, Contact by Tel: 9026432057
Map
Google Map of Peter S Lobster Ltd address:3905 Hwy 3,Glenwood,Canada.
If you find 'Can Not Find' or error address, please submit another address using the form in the map, then search again.
If you find 'Can Not Find' or error address, please submit another address using the form in the map, then search again.
Other Related Business